ZooKeeper管理与监控:ZooInspector工具介绍
需积分: 0 79 浏览量
更新于2024-11-02
收藏 1.55MB ZIP 举报
资源摘要信息:"ZooKeeper 是一个开源的分布式协调服务,它为分布式应用提供了高性能的协调服务。ZooKeeper 管理工具是一个图形界面,用于简化对 ZooKeeper 服务器的管理和监控。用户可以通过这个工具查看和操作 ZooKeeper 服务器上的数据节点(Znodes),监控服务器状态,以及执行一些管理任务,例如创建、删除、修改节点,查看节点数据以及执行子节点的监听等。
ZooKeeper 管理工具通常具备以下功能:
1. 连接和配置 ZooKeeper 服务器:用户可以指定 ZooKeeper 服务器的地址和端口,进行连接配置。
2. 查看数据模型:以树状结构展示 ZooKeeper 中的数据节点(Znodes)和它们之间的层级关系。
3. 数据浏览:查看选定节点的数据内容和属性,包括节点的版本信息、权限设置等。
4. 节点操作:允许用户创建新节点,更新节点数据,删除节点以及对节点进行重命名。
5. 监控和通知:监控节点数据变更和子节点的创建或删除事件,可以设置监听器来在特定事件发生时接收通知。
6. 会话管理:查看、管理客户端与 ZooKeeper 服务器之间的会话状态,包括会话的超时和过期处理。
7. 服务器状态监控:查看 ZooKeeper 集群中各个服务器的状态信息,包括leader、follower等角色的服务器。
执行 build 下执行 start.bat即可运行,表明这是一个使用 Java 开发的客户端工具。用户需要在项目根目录下执行特定的构建命令(可能是如 'gradlew build' 或 'mvn clean package' 等),之后在项目目录中的特定位置找到 start.bat 文件并执行它,便可以启动 ZooKeeper 管理工具的图形界面。
通过这个图形界面,开发者可以更直观地对 ZooKeeper 进行操作和管理。对于没有深入接触过 ZooKeeper 的开发者来说,这是一条快速上手的捷径,而对于经验丰富的开发者而言,它可以提高管理效率,快速定位和解决问题。"
标签 "zookeeper 管理工具 java 客户端" 显示,这个管理工具是由 Java 编程语言开发的客户端应用。Java 作为一种广泛使用的编程语言,对于构建跨平台的应用程序有先天优势,因此开发 ZooKeeper 管理工具的开发者选择了 Java,以便工具能够运行在包括 Windows、Linux 和 MacOS 等多种操作系统上。
文件名称列表中的 "ZooInspector" 很可能是这个 ZooKeeper 管理工具的具体名称。这个名字暗示了这个工具可能提供了某种形式的“监督”或“检查”ZooKeeper集群的功能,让管理员能够深入“洞察”集群的状态和行为。
在使用 ZooKeeper 管理工具时,管理员或开发者需要确保已经正确安装了 JDK(Java 开发环境),并且已经配置了合适的环境变量,以便能够执行构建和启动工具所需的命令。对于一个以批处理文件(.bat)来启动的应用,通常意味着它是为了简化在 Windows 环境中的部署和使用。而使用命令行来启动界面的方式,也表明了这个工具的客户端版本可能是一个简单的 GUI 应用,易于用户操作,但可能缺乏一些企业级应用的高级功能。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2022-06-05 上传
2018-12-02 上传
2016-07-01 上传
2019-01-30 上传
142 浏览量
2020-12-22 上传
catchthatelf
- 粉丝: 1w+
- 资源: 65
最新资源
- Angular实现MarcHayek简历展示应用教程
- Crossbow Spot最新更新 - 获取Chrome扩展新闻
- 量子管道网络优化与Python实现
- Debian系统中APT缓存维护工具的使用方法与实践
- Python模块AccessControl的Windows64位安装文件介绍
- 掌握最新*** Fisher资讯,使用Google Chrome扩展
- Ember应用程序开发流程与环境配置指南
- EZPCOpenSDK_v5.1.2_build***版本更新详情
- Postcode-Finder:利用JavaScript和Google Geocode API实现
- AWS商业交易监控器:航线行为分析与营销策略制定
- AccessControl-4.0b6压缩包详细使用教程
- Python编程实践与技巧汇总
- 使用Sikuli和Python打造颜色求解器项目
- .Net基础视频教程:掌握GDI绘图技术
- 深入理解数据结构与JavaScript实践项目
- 双子座在线裁判系统:提高编程竞赛效率